数控编程铣床用什么系统
-
数控编程铣床常用的系统包括:
- 通用数控系统(CNC)
- 西门子数控系统(Siemens CNC)
- 高斯数控系统(Fanuc CNC)
- 国产数控系统(GSK CNC)
- 迈阿密(Mach3)数控系统
通用数控系统(CNC)是一种通用的数控编程系统,可以适用于不同型号、不同品牌的数控机床。它具有良好的兼容性和稳定性,可以满足大部分数控编程的需求。
西门子数控系统(Siemens CNC)是德国西门子公司生产的一种功能强大的数控编程系统。它具有先进的功能、高精度、稳定性好等特点,广泛应用于各种大型数控机床。
高斯数控系统(Fanuc CNC)是日本高斯机械公司生产的一种世界知名的数控编程系统。它具有良好的稳定性和高效性能,在全球范围内应用广泛。
国产数控系统(GSK CNC)是我国自主研发生产的一种数控编程系统。它在性能和价格方面具有竞争优势,并且适用于各种中小型数控机床。
迈阿密(Mach3)数控系统是一种相对简单易用的数控编程系统,主要适用于个人和小型工作室使用的数控机床。它具有良好的性价比,适合初学者学习和使用。
根据不同的需求和预算,可以选择适合自己的数控系统。以上所提及的系统都有各自的特点和优势,可以根据具体情况进行选择。
1年前 -
数控编程铣床通常使用的系统有以下几种:
-
数控系统:
数控编程铣床最常用的系统是数控系统,包括传统的数控系统和高级的数控系统。传统的数控系统使用G代码和M代码来进行编程,控制铣床的各种动作,如进给速度、进给量、切削速度等。而高级的数控系统可以通过图形界面来进行编程,使操作更加简便。 -
CAD/CAM系统:
CAD/CAM系统是辅助设计和制造的软件系统,可以实现设计、下料、排样、工艺分析、工装夹具设计等功能。在数控编程铣床中,CAD/CAM系统可以进行零件的三维建模和零件的刀具路径生成,然后导出到数控系统进行加工。 -
仿真系统:
为了验证程序的正确性和避免机床碰撞,数控编程铣床常常使用仿真系统。仿真系统可以对刀具路径进行模拟,并可通过三维模型显示加工过程,以检验程序是否正确。 -
自动化系统:
在一些高级的数控编程铣床中,还可以使用自动化系统来实现自动换刀、自动工件装卸等功能。自动化系统通过机械手臂或其他设备,实现工件的自动装夹和刀具的自动更换,大大提高了铣床的加工效率。 -
数据管理系统:
数控编程铣床中的数据管理系统可以对零件、刀具和加工工艺等进行管理。通过数据管理系统,可以对各种数据进行分类、存储和检索,方便程序员进行编程和工艺设计。
综上所述,数控编程铣床通常使用的系统包括数控系统、CAD/CAM系统、仿真系统、自动化系统和数据管理系统。不同的系统可以根据具体需求进行选择和组合,以实现铣床的高效加工。
1年前 -
-
数控编程的系统在不同的铣床型号和品牌之间可能存在差异。但一般常见的数控编程系统有以下几种:
-
G代码编程系统:G代码是一种通用化的机器语言,用于控制数控铣床进行加工。通过编写G代码程序,可以指定铣刀的切削速度、进给速度、进给方向等参数,从而实现加工工件的功能。
-
CAD/CAM系统:CAD(计算机辅助设计)和CAM(计算机辅助制造)系统是目前常用的数控编程方法之一。通过CAD系统(如AutoCAD、SolidWorks等)来完成零件的三维建模,然后使用CAM系统(如Mastercam、Powermill等)将零件的三维模型转化为数控编程代码。CAD/CAM系统具有图形化界面,通过鼠标操作可以轻松绘制零件的几何形状,并根据加工要求生成相应的加工路径与刀具轨迹。
-
可视化编程系统:可视化编程系统通常具有图形化界面,可通过拖动和组合图标、菜单等方式来生成数控编程代码。这种编程方式对于不懂机器语言的操作者来说更加友好,不需要直接书写和理解复杂的代码,只需选择相应的图标与参数即可生成对应的编程指令。
-
NC语言编程系统:NC(Numeric Control)语言是一种类似于G代码的编程语言,用于编写数控程序。NC语言具有特定的语法规则,需要操作者熟悉并且能够理解和书写编程程序,包括定义零点坐标、设定进给速度、切削转速、刀具半径补偿等。
总结:不同的铣床可能使用不同的数控编程系统,常见的有G代码编程系统、CAD/CAM系统、可视化编程系统以及NC语言编程系统。选择合适的数控编程系统取决于铣床的型号、操作者的编程经验以及加工件的要求。需要根据实际情况选择适合的编程方式,对铣床进行编程操作。
1年前 -